YELLOWKNIFE - Yellowknife gift shops and florists are ready for this Sunday's Mother's Day rush.

On any other day its business as usual for Marie Chenard, manager of Flowers by Manuela, however, on Wednesday morning, she was busy preparing flowers and arrangements before customers rushed in to make last minute orders.

"Mother's Day is the busiest time of the year for florists," said Chenard. "We had to order quite a bit more stock."

The most popular flower is the carnation, said Chenard.

Shoppers looking for the right gift, browsed through special vases, little grow your own tree kits, and chocolate boxes.

Kerry Yamkowy at Sasha's Jewellery Store is also enthused about Mother's Day.

According to Yamkowy, it generates more business and is more popular then Valentines Day.

The most popular gift for Mother's Day this year is the small Canadian diamond, said Yamkowy.

Charmaine Broadhead, said that she will likely make her mother breakfast in bed and give her a foot massage. As for Eric Farquhar, he is still trying to decide whether to buy his mother earrings or a painting.
